No Setoff or Deductions; Taxes. Each Guarantor represents and warrants that it is incorporated or formed, and resides in, the United States of America. All payments by each Guarantor hereunder shall be paid in full, without setoff or counterclaim (other than mandatory) or any deduction or withholding whatsoever, including, without limitation, for any and all present and future Taxes, except as required by applicable Law. If a Guarantor must make a payment under this Guaranty, such Guarantor represents, warrants and covenants that it will make the payment from one of its U.S. resident offices to the Administrative Agent or each other Guarantied Party. If any Guarantor makes a payment under this Guaranty on which any Indemnified Taxes or Other Taxes are at any time imposed including, but not limited to, payments made pursuant to this Section 21, each Guarantor shall pay all such Indemnified Taxes or Other Taxes to the relevant authority in accordance with applicable Law such that the Administrative Agent or any other Guarantied Party receives the sum it would have received had no such deduction or withholding for Indemnified Taxes or Other Taxes been made and shall also pay to the Administrative Agent or any other Guarantied Party, on demand, all additional amounts which the Administrative Agent or any other Guarantied Party specifies as necessary to preserve the after-tax yield the Administrative Agent or such other Guarantied Party would have received if such Indemnified Taxes or Other Taxes had not been imposed. Each Guarantor shall promptly provide the Administrative Agent or any other Guarantied Party with the original or a certified copy of a receipt issued by the relevant authority evidencing the payment of any such amount required to be deducted or withheld or other evidence of such payment reasonably satisfactory to the Administrative Agent or such other Guarantied Party.

No Setoff or Deductions; Taxes. Guarantor represents and warrants that it is incorporated or formed and resident in the United States of America. All payments by Guarantor hereunder shall be paid in full, without setoff or counterclaim or any deduction or withholding whatsoever, including, without limitation, for any and all present and future Indemnified Taxes or Other Taxes. If Guarantor shall be required by any Laws to deduct any Indemnified Taxes (including any Other Taxes) from or in respect of any sum payable under this Guaranty to any Guaranteed Party, (i) the sum payable shall be increased as necessary so that after making all required deductions, each Guaranteed Party receives an amount equal to the sum it would have received had no such deductions been made, (ii) Guarantor shall make such deductions, (iii) Guarantor shall pay the full amount deducted to the relevant taxation authority or other authority in accordance with applicable Laws, and (iv) within 30 days after the date of such payment, Guarantor shall furnish to Administrative Agent (which shall forward the same to the applicable Guaranteed Parties) the original or a certified copy of a receipt evidencing payment thereof.

No Setoff or Deductions; Taxes. Each Guarantor represents and warrants that it is a “United States person” within the meaning of Section 7701(a)(30) of the Internal Revenue Code of 1986, as amended. All payments by each Guarantor hereunder shall be paid in full, without setoff or counterclaim or any deduction or withholding whatsoever, including, without limitation, for any and all present and future taxes, except as required by applicable law. If any Guarantor must make a payment under this Guaranty, such Guarantor represents and warrants that it will make the payment from one of its U.S. resident offices to the Lender Parties so that no withholding tax is imposed on the payment to the extent permitted by applicable law. If notwithstanding the foregoing, a Guarantor makes a payment under this Guaranty to which withholding tax or other tax applies, the Guarantor’s payment shall be increased, or the Lender Parties shall be indemnified, as applicable, as and to the extent provided in Section 3.10 of the Loan Agreement.
